The Defense Health Agency Contracting Activity, Healthcare Contracting Division South intends to award a sole source requirement for Abbott ID Now molecular analyzers and testing kits, on a Cost-Per-Kit basis, for Naval Hospital Pensacola, Florida, to Abbott Rapid DX North America LLC (Cage Code: 5C4F2) located at 30 S Keller Rd Ste 100, Orlando, Florida 32810-6297 under the authority of FAR Part 13.501(a)(1)(ii). This notice is neither a request for competitive quotations nor a solicitation of offers. A determination by the Government to compete this requirement based on responses to this notice is solely within the discretion of the Government. Information received will be considered solely for the purpose of determining whether to conduct a competitive procurement. Interested companies may identify their interest and capability to satisfy the requirement. Responses to this notice should include: 1. Written narrative (not to exceed 1 page) of Contractors capability to provide Abbott ID Now molecular analyzers and testing kits, on a Cost-Per-Kit basis, as follows: Abbott Part Number Description Estimated Quantity NAT-024 ID NOW Instrument Approximately 12 units to support 22,317 tests per year 427-000 ID NOW Flu (Influenza A/B), 24 per kit, Includes swabs and controls 8,533 tests per year 192-000 ID NOW COVID-19, 24 tests per kit, Includes swabs and controls 8,591 tests per year 734-000 ID NOW Strep A, 24 tests per kit, Includes swabs and controls 4,983 tests per year 435-000 ID NOW RSV, 24 tests per kit, Includes swabs and controls 210 tests per year 2. Company Size in relation to the applicable North American Industry Classification System code (NAICS) 334516, Analytical Laboratory Instrument Manufacturing; 3. Commercial and Government Entity; 4. The socioeconomic status of the company, i.e., small business concerns, 8(a) business, HUB Zone small business, small disadvantaged business, women-owned small business, veteran- owned small business; 5. There is a future possibility of additional Abbott ID Now molecular analyzers and testing kits to be added under the resultant contract from this Notice of Intent. These additional commodities would cover Military Treatment Facilities under the DHACA HCD-S Area of Responsibility. 6. Point of Contact information to include name, email address and telephone number. Responses to this notice should be emailed to the Contract Specialist, Mr. Sylas Younger at sylas.a.younger.civ@health.mil or the Contracting Officer, Mr. Marcus Mattingly at marcus.h.mattingly.civ@health.mil. Responses must be received no later than 4:00 P.M. CT on 26 May 2025.
